Blender vs Food Processor: Core Differences
A blender is designed to blend/liquefy ingredients into a smooth, pourable result—think soups, smoothies, and creamy sauces. A food processor is designed to chop, slice, shred, and mix thicker blends—making it the better tool for prep-heavy cooking and recipes that benefit from controlled particle size.
A blender’s spinning blade creates a high-shear, vortex blending pattern that emulsifies fats and liquids into uniform textures.
A food processor uses a rotating blade plus interchangeable discs to produce consistent cuts for tasks like slicing, shredding, and julienning.
Texture outcomes usually come down to blade geometry and processing method: blenders “liquefy,” food processors “chop/cut.”
When I compare these two tools in my own cooking routine, the practical difference shows up fastest in two places: (1) whether the end product needs to be fully smooth, and (2) how often you want repeatable prep (slices, shreds, and evenly cut pieces). In early-2025, I tested both by making the same weeknight template: roasted vegetables (sliced + shredded), then a blended soup for leftovers. The blender delivered a consistently silky soup; the food processor delivered faster, more uniform vegetable preparation with less hand work.
Both devices also handle “mixing,” but they mix differently. A blender pulls ingredients toward the blade and breaks them down aggressively; that’s why smoothies and creamy sauces work so well. A food processor has less emphasis on liquefying and more on cutting and pulsing—so it’s better for pie crust crumbs, thicker pesto, and cookie dough that shouldn’t become paste-like.
Q: Can a blender replace a food processor for chopping?
Often, but not reliably—blenders can turn chopped ingredients into uneven slurries unless you use very short pulses and enough liquid control.
Q: Can a food processor replace a blender for smoothies?
Sometimes for thicker smoothies, but you’ll usually get less smoothness because food processors prioritize cutting over full emulsification.

Best Uses for a Blender
A blender is the better buy when your top recipes require smooth, fully blended textures that look and pour like they came from a café. If your routine includes soups, creamy sauces, and drinks, a blender will usually deliver more “repeatable smooth” results with less technique.
Blenders excel at converting whole ingredients into uniform purées because the blade repeatedly re-circulates material through a tight mixing zone.
For smoothies, a blender’s ability to shear and emulsify helps reduce “grit” by breaking down fibrous ingredients.
Smooth purees that stay silky
If you frequently make soups (tomato, butternut, curry), hummus, refried beans, or baby food, a blender is purpose-built for the job. You can blend hot liquids carefully (when your model supports hot blending) and reach consistent smoothness without multiple passes. In my own tests, blender purées stay cohesive longer—especially for soups—because the liquid phase blends and stabilizes the texture.
Practical examples:
– Hummus: Blend chickpeas with tahini, garlic, lemon, and water until smooth; a blender reduces graininess.
– Baby food: Steam and blend in batches to a smooth, spoonable consistency; you control thickness by adding liquid.
– Creamy sauces: Blend roasted peppers into sauces for an even, “restaurant-style” finish.
Drinks, ice, and emulsions
Blenders are also the tool of choice for smoothies, milkshakes, and cocktails. The reason is simple: emulsification. When fats (like milk, yogurt, nut butter, or cream) meet water-based ingredients, blenders help form a stable mixture so you get a uniform mouthfeel rather than separated layers.

Best Uses for a Food Processor
A food processor is the better buy if your kitchen is heavy on prep: chopping onions, slicing vegetables, shredding cheese, and assembling meals quickly. It’s also the right tool when thickness matters and you want to avoid over-liquefying—like pie crusts, cookie dough, and pesto.
Food processors can produce uniform slices and shreds using interchangeable discs, which reduces uneven cooking and prep time.
Pulse-based processing is key for doughs and thick mixtures, preventing the mixture from turning into paste.
Prep tasks with consistency
If you meal prep or cook for a household, the food processor earns its spot. The ability to slice and shred consistently changes the whole workflow: less time at the cutting board, more even roasting, and fewer “some pieces cook faster than others” problems.
Common wins:
– Onions and aromatics: chop onions quickly for soups, sauces, and stir-fries
– Cheese and vegetables: shred cheddar, slice carrots, and grate garlic-friendly aromatics
– Salads and bowls: shred cabbage for slaws and bowls with uniform textures
From my hands-on experience, food processor discs are especially valuable for “repeat” recipes. When you’re making chili, nachos, or sheet-pan dinners weekly, consistency reduces cooking variance.
Doughs and thicker blends
Food processors outperform blenders for thicker mixes because they cut more than they liquefy. That means better control for:
– Pie crusts: pulsed butter + flour for tender, flaky texture (no need to over-blend)
– Cookie dough: mix until just combined
– Pesto: chop basil and nuts while keeping a chunkier, aromatic texture (or purée further if you want, but you start from better control)

Capacity, Power, and Ease of Cleaning
A blender is often easier to use for liquid batches and quick drinks, while a food processor is designed for larger prep volumes and more attachments. Your best purchase depends on capacity for the sizes you actually cook and on how much cleaning friction you’ll tolerate in 2024–2026.
Countertop blender jar sizes often range from single-serve to family-batch volumes, changing both batch consistency and convenience.
Food processors add cleaning steps because discs, blades, and bowls require separate rinsing and safe handling.
Capacity: match the batch you cook
Ask two questions:
1) How many servings do I blend or prep at once?
If you usually make 1–2 servings, single-serve blender cups reduce waste and time. If you meal prep for 4–6 people, a larger processor bowl (or blender jar) saves repeat batches.
2) Do I rely on batching because of overflow?
In my use, overflow is the silent performance killer: too full and ingredients don’t circulate well; too empty and blades don’t pull properly.
Power: more isn’t always better, but it matters
Power affects whether the tool can handle:
– ice and frozen fruit (blenders)
– thick dough or dense chopping (processors)
– tough greens and fibrous ingredients (both, depending on design)
A practical buying mindset is to check real-world specs and user-reported results for your exact ingredients—ice, kale, chickpeas, nuts, and dense veg—not just marketing wattage.
Cleaning: fewer parts usually wins
Blenders typically require fewer parts (jar + blade assembly). Food processors may require rinsing:
– bowl
– main blade
– discs (slicing/shredding)
– sometimes a feed chute assembly
If you cook daily, cleanup time becomes part of the “true cost.” In my own routine, I choose the tool that I’ll actually reach for—not the one that’s theoretically best.

Why might my blender or food processor struggle with thick blends like nut butter or hummus?
Thick blends like nut butter and hummus can be challenging because the mixture may not circulate properly around the blades, causing uneven texture or requiring repeated stops and scrapes. Food processors often perform better for thicker pastes due to their bowl shape and ability to pulse and scrape, which helps ingredients move and break down evenly. Blenders can still work, but you may need the right blend program, more stopping to scrape, and a strategy for adding oil or liquid gradually.
